NEEDLES—A Panorama City, Calif. man was arrested Saturday in Needles following a pursuit with deputies.
According to a press release, authorities were notified about a possible stolen vehicle traveling eastbound Interstate 40 and in the direction of Needles. A San Bernardino County Sheriff’s Office Colorado River Station deputy was reportedly checking for the vehicle at local businesses when the vehicle was observed parked at the Mobil Gas Station, 2400 Needles Highway.
Darin Robert Sanders, 41, was allegedly inside the vehicle and noticed the sheriff deputy. At that time Sanders reportedly drove away from the gas station at a high rate of speed, traveling east on Needles Highway.
After a brief pursuit down River Road and Marina Boulevard, Sanders was apprehended south of Jack Smith Park and taken into custody following a reported struggle with authorities.
Sanders was subsequently taken to the Colorado River Station jail and booked on suspicion of possession of a stolen vehicle, felony evading, and driving under the influence. Sanders is being held on $175,000.00 bail pending a court hearing.
